Plastics: The Backbone of Modern Industry
Plastics have become an indispensable part of modern life and industrial production. From packaging, automotive, and construction to healthcare and electronics, plastics offer lightweight, durable, cost-effective, and versatile solutions.
According to Renub Research Latest Report plastic market, valued at $626.34 billion in 2024, is projected to reach $894.57 billion by 2033, growing at a CAGR of 4.04% from 2025 to 2033. Growth is primarily driven by rising demand across industries, rapid technological developments, the expansion of emerging economies, government regulations, and a shift toward recyclable and biodegradable plastics.
Packaging remains the largest segment, thanks to its role in food safety, product preservation, and logistics efficiency. In the automotive industry, lightweight plastic parts reduce emissions and improve fuel efficiency, while construction uses plastics for windows, pipes, insulation, and flooring. Advancements in engineering plastics and composites have expanded high-performance applications, and healthcare relies on plastics for prosthetics, sterile packaging, and disposable medical devices.
Major industry players are investing heavily in capacity and innovation. For example, Reliance Industries’ Oil-to-Chemicals division reported an 11% YoY revenue increase in April 2025, accelerating PVC production and adding a 1-million-ton polyester capacity. Similarly, GAIL committed INR 300 billion over three years for additional pipeline and petrochemical assets, including the acquisition of JBF Petrochemicals’ PTA facility.
Despite rapid growth, the industry faces environmental scrutiny, particularly concerning single-use plastics and waste management. Governments and organizations are promoting recycling, bio-based plastics, and circular economy models, while technological advancements in plastic processing and recycling are reshaping market dynamics.
Key Drivers of Plastic Market Growth
1. Rapid Technological Development
Technological breakthroughs in manufacturing, processing, and recycling have revolutionized the plastics industry. Innovations enable the production of plastics with enhanced strength, biodegradability, or unique properties, fueling market expansion.
The rise of bioplastics provides eco-friendly alternatives aligned with global sustainability goals. Similarly, modern recycling technologies are transforming post-use plastic management, reducing environmental impact.
Additionally, 3D printing is creating new opportunities for customized, on-demand plastic products, opening niche markets in medical devices, industrial components, and consumer goods.
2. Emerging Markets Driving Demand
Rapid industrialization, urbanization, and rising consumer spending power make emerging markets pivotal for growth. These regions demand plastics for consumer goods, construction, automotive, and infrastructure development, driving market expansion.
Plastics are vital in housing, water systems, and transportation networks, offering durability and affordability. The rising middle class further fuels demand for consumer electronics, packaging, and vehicles. Local manufacturing capacity expansion is also enabling broader domestic applications.
3. Diverse Industrial Applications
Plastics’ versatility ensures extensive usage across sectors:
Automotive: Lightweight parts improve fuel efficiency and performance
Packaging: Durable, preservative properties for food, medical, and e-commerce products
Construction: Insulation, piping, and flooring materials
Healthcare: Disposable medical devices, equipment housings, and sterile packaging
This diversity across industries underpins consistent market growth, despite environmental and regulatory pressures.
Challenges Facing the Plastic Market
1. Environmental and Waste Management Issues
Plastic waste, especially from single-use items, poses serious environmental challenges. Improper disposal and limited recycling infrastructure contribute to ecosystem contamination and public health risks.
Governments are responding with bans, taxes, or restrictions on single-use plastics. Changing consumer preferences and corporate responsibility initiatives are pressuring companies to adopt biodegradable or recyclable alternatives, emphasizing circular economy practices.
Balancing performance, cost-effectiveness, and environmental sustainability remains a key challenge for industry players, with long-term viability dependent on innovative recycling, extended producer responsibility, and sustainable design.
2. Raw Material Price Volatility and Supply Chain Disruptions
Plastics rely heavily on petrochemical feedstocks, making the industry vulnerable to crude oil and natural gas price fluctuations. Geopolitical tensions, trade restrictions, and logistical bottlenecks, such as container shortages, further impact production costs and scheduling.
The integration of bio-based feedstocks adds complexity to supply chains. Manufacturers must diversify raw material sources, invest in regional supply chains, and implement flexible strategies to mitigate risks.
Regional Market Insights
United States
The U.S. plastic market is driven by packaging, construction, automotive, and medical applications. A robust manufacturing base and established petrochemical industry support innovation in sustainable plastics, recycling technologies, and polymer development.
Environmental consciousness and regulatory pressures are accelerating the adoption of recycled and bio-based plastics. Corporate and government initiatives are investing in circular economy solutions, ensuring continued growth despite challenges with waste management and public perception.
Germany
Germany emphasizes quality, innovation, and environmental compliance, positioning itself as a leader in high-performance polymers for automotive and engineering applications.
Sustainability and recycling are central to German plastic manufacturing, with strong collaboration between industry and research institutions to advance biodegradable plastics and circular economy models. Investments in smart materials and green technologies further strengthen the market.
India
India’s plastic market is expanding rapidly, fueled by retail, packaging, infrastructure, and agriculture sectors. Urbanization and rising consumer demand are driving increased plastic usage across applications.
The packaging industry, particularly food and e-commerce packaging, is a major growth driver. Government initiatives to promote recycling and reduce single-use plastics, alongside investments in plastic parks, are transforming the market toward sustainability and circular solutions.
United Arab Emirates
The UAE aims to diversify its industrial base while prioritizing sustainability. Key sectors include consumer goods, packaging, construction, and automotive.
Government incentives, public awareness campaigns, and investments in recycling infrastructure are accelerating sustainable practices. The nation is positioning itself as a regional hub for plastic production and innovation, including bio-based alternatives.

Recent Developments in the Plastic Industry
India’s Plastic Parks (April 2025): The Department of Chemicals and Petrochemicals launched initiatives to boost domestic plastic processing, creating jobs and promoting investment.
Vehicle Plastics Recycling (February 2025): The Global Impact Coalition partnered with BASF, Sabic, Covestro, Clariant, LyondellBasell, Mitsubishi Chemical Group, and Solvay to recycle end-of-life vehicle plastics.
These developments highlight government support, industry collaboration, and sustainability-focused innovation, indicating the sector’s adaptation to environmental and regulatory demands.
